ADQ's Dumont pushes Quebec's autonomy within Canada

QUEBEC -- Mario Dumont, the bold, controversial leader of Quebec's third party, has once again rocked the political establishment by proposing an aggressive nationalist shift to turn the province into an autonomous state within Canada.
